InterneTree: Sheila M Appleton Hopper family. 3 generations in Wolsingham, Durham mostly Stone masons, then William and Ann Hopper (1808, Wolsingham, Durham - Robert Hopper (1837, Wolsingham)(family moved to London) married Emma Hughes - William Hopper (1867, Westminster, London) married Mary Potier (French) - Henry Hopper (1888,Portsmouth)The early hoppers were Stone masons. From 1887 they were Royal Navy men and lived in Portsmouth, U.K. until Dad joined the RAF in WW2! Common names - John, William, Robert, Joseph, Emma. Dannan family. Richard and Ann Dannan (or Danan)(c.1860) Also in the Royal Navy. The Dannan family originated in Cornwall,U.K. (Robert and Hester Dannan (1680)moved to Devizes in the 1700's and to Portsmouth in the 1800's. Common names - Robert, John, William, Richard James, Ester, Mary. Henry Alfred Hopper(25.12.1888) married Minnie Beatrice Dannan (2.6.1892) on 5.5.1914. Russ family. James Russ (1840) walked to London from Wiltshire circa 1865.. He married Sophie Melton 1872.I've traced the Russ family back to Joseph and Elizabeth Russ who married about 1742 and lived in Ramsbury, Wiltshire. James parents lived in Aldbourne, Wilts. and had 18 children! Common names - John, James, Joseph, StephSheila Mary Appleton |

The Akin Family home is located in Fresno and still exists. The Akin's are buried in Easton Cemetery, just north of Fresno. They are from Titusville and Oil City, PA. Charles Hopper is the son of Thomas Hopper. He came to CA as the scout of the Bartelson Bidwell wagon train in 1841. He returned 5 years later with his wife and children. He is from NC. The Cooper Family home is located in Yolo County and is also still standing. It is still in the family. The Cooper's came from KY and MO. |
